Curtis Lamar Thomas' Obituary
Curtis Lamar Thomas was born March 28, 1981 to Carol and Michael Thomas in Indianapolis, Indiana. Curtis loved to listen to music and enjoyed being with his family. He was preceded in death by his grandparents, Martha and Phil Woods; and Evelyn and Charles Thomas. Curtis was a loving son, Father, Brother and Uncle. He leaves to cherish his Mother, Carol Thomas; (three brothers), Michael, Anthony and Gregory, all of Muskegon, Michigan; a loving daughter Carlisa Thomas of Muskegon, Michigan; (one sister), Monessy Griffan of Horn Lake, MS; a Great Aunt, Mary Blair of Indianapolis, Indiana; (three nieces), Kyla, Charlize, Jazelle Thomas of Muskegon, Michigan; (five Aunts), Georgia, Rosemary, Linda Woods all of Indianapolis, Indiana; Patricia Shelly of Pace, MS, and Marcella Thomas of Indianapolis, Indiana; (four Uncle's), Tony, Baril, Von Woods of Indianapolis, Indiana, Lloyd Woods of Pace MS; a special cousin Marvin Hollands of Indianapolis, Indiana; and a host of other cousins and friends.
